From November 25, 2022, two bus shuttles will connect the most beautiful and significant places in the Campi Flegrei: a free service that will make visiting this wonderful land more accessible and comfortable.
From November 25, 2022, to January 15, 2023, you can reach the area's archaeological sites with this service planned and financed by Regione Campania. The initiative is part of the activities scheduled within the Procida Capital of Culture 2022 framework.
Daedalo was born: an essential project for developing tourism in the Phlegraean area that owes its name to a legend. It is based on Daedalus, who flew away from Crete and arrived at the top of the city of Cumae to found the temple of Apollo. Moreover, this name suggests the rich Phlegrean road network, thus juxtaposed to Minos's labyrinth, which Daedalus himself designed. Which one better than its builder can guide visitors through this intricate network, leading them to their destination and letting them discover the beauty of this land?
Hop on board for free and visit the most beautiful spots in the Campi Flegrei

During this pre-Christmas period and all holidays until January 15, 2023, from Thursday to Sunday, from 9.00 a.m. to 6.00 p.m., two shuttle buses will be providing their service. With approximately 30 seats each, they will operate 10 daily circular trips around the Campi Flegrei. The scheduled stops include the following sites of archaeological and cultural interest: Macellum of Pozzuoli, Rione Terra, Flavian Amphitheatre, Cuma Archaeological Park, Campi Flegrei Archaeological Museum in the Baia Castle, Baia Underwater Park, Baia Thermal Baths Archaeological Park, Piscina Mirabilis and the Casina Vanvitelliana.
The two shuttles will cover two different routes, with their meeting point at the port of Baia to make your visit to the Campi Flegrei easier. From here, passengers can move from one bus to another to visit all the interesting points. The route of the first shuttle includes a series of stops marked by special signs installed at the Eav bus stops. This shuttle departs from Pozzuoli, heading for Cuma, Lake Averno and Baia (Bacoli) and then returns to Pozzuoli. The second shuttle starts its tour at Torregaveta station and then continues to Monte di Procida, Miseno, Baia (Bacoli), with a return and subsequent departure again from Torregaveta.
This pilot service is totally free of charge and all you need to do is to get the ticket "Dedalo Pass" within the dedicated section on the platform SVR di campania>artecard.
The free purchase ends with the receipt of the "Procida Insieme" card, which entitles Artecard holders to have reserved seats to enjoy the marvellous shows in the rich Procida 2022 programme.
To check Dedalo's timetables, download the Moovit app. This project partner also gives access to information and timelines of all means of transport in Naples and its province. It allows travellers to enjoy an immersive and perfectly integrated experience. The initiative is also aimed to improve tourism's impact in terms of environmental sustainability.

If you want to visit all the archaeological sites in the Campi Flegrei, you need more than one week! As a matter of fact, there are as many as 25 archaeological sites. You can visit the most interesting attractions during the weekend, such as the Piscina Mirabilis, the Castle of Baia with the Archaeological Museum, the Archaeological Excavations of Cuma, and the Baths of Baia. You should combine nature experiences such as the views of Monte di Procida, the port of Acquamorta, the Torrefumo walk and trekking on Monte Nuovo.
